Transaction 618f41542f5f4eb9b51422337de8f68d6ef1250a54f147d43b528d3bfcb22b87
1 Input
1 Output
-
618f41542f5f4eb9b51422337de8f68d6ef1250a54f147d43b528d3bfcb22b87:0
- value
- 357043
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 18ae311700b17dcfafff624915d51ee40e204916 OP_EQUAL
- address
- 33wWpCjgDUjiPUr53WfK26QTGwoW39xSZD